首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
iOS
订阅
EchoZuo98
更多收藏集
微信扫码分享
微信
新浪微博
QQ
9篇文章 · 0订阅
iOS启动时间监控
启动优化 一. 启动时间的定义 启动时间有着不同的理解和定义, 大致可以分为2种 用户侧(广义): 点击图标 -> 首页数据加载完毕 开发侧(狭义): 进程创建 -> Launch Image完全消失
iOS小技能:【idfa的使用】(适配iOS15下无法弹出IDFA权限申请视图)
问题背景:ios审核被拒,iOS15下无法弹出IDFA权限申请视图 We're looking forward to completing our review, but we need more
IOS设备唯一标识设置策略
ios14版本直接获取idfa,idfv,UUID等不可靠。策略是将获取到的idfa,idfv或生成的UUID存储到keychain。获取UUID代码:obf_DeviceUUID_fuc.hobf_
Swift - Codable 使用小记
Codable 简介 Codable 协议在 Swift4.0 开始被引入,目标是取代现有的 NSCoding 协议,它对结构体,枚举和类都支持。Codable 的引入简化了JSON 和 Swift
弱符号实现 iOS 组件化解耦
今天在重温《程序员的自我修养》中关于符号表的章节时,突然脑子灵光一现,想到了这个知识的一个应用场景,所以便有了这篇文章。 若对 iOS 组件化不太了解,可以看笔者的另一篇文章:解读 iOS 组件化与路由的本质,本文主要是谈一下如何利用弱符号来实现 iOS 组件化解耦。 函数和全…
给iOS中高级求职者的一份面试题解答
1、原子操作对线程安全并无任何安全保证。被 atomic 修饰的属性(不重载设置器和访问器)只保证了对数据读写的完整性,也就是原子性,但是与对象的线程安全无关。 2、线程安全有保障、对性能有要求的情况下可使用 nonatomic替代atomic,当然也可以一直使用atomic。…
Xcode 11 初体验
将 Version Editor 中的 log 选项卡移到了检查器中,组成了新的Source Control History区。 将 Assistant、和 Vesion Editor下的 Autor 选项卡合并为一项,并从主导航中移除,向下移到每个编辑面板中,组成 Edito…
iOS13 Compositional Layout
UITableView 和 UICollectionView 是我们开发者最常用的控件了,大量的流式布局需要这两个控件来实现,因此这两个控件也是 Apple 重点优化的对象。在往届 WWDC 中,我们已经受益于 UITableViewDataSourcePrefetching …
[MetalKit]0-instruction说明及目录
学习本系列需要有以下基础:swift基础语法知识C/C++基础知识OpenGLES基础知识iOS或Mac相关开发经验目录:instruction说明及目录Introducing介绍MetalUsing